Simpler access to placing alerts
I suggest making it easier to reach the alert screen when trying to report police, accident etc. right now it takes 3 screens to reach the proper icon. Consider making it a shortcut where perhaps the user can select to have shortcut icons on the main nav screen so that it would only take one tap to report a situation. Maybe allow users to have 2 or 3 favorite or most useful icons, like police or disabled vehicles. Would make it safer as well since the driver wouldn’t have to be distracted by navigating multiple screens to report an jssue

Add a Selection of how much time you would need to save in order to change the standard directions to a re-route
This is my favorite navigation app. It is easy to read and gives great directions. The only negative part is that it will have you drive pretty far just to save a minute or two if they could add a feature where the user could of how many minutes are saved by leaving the more standard route, it would be absolutely perfect.
The worse directions I have received have been 1) Getting off a Los Angeles freeway exit, to only return right back on and 2) drive an additional 3 miles to improvement the total time by one single minute.

Hide “Work” shortcut in CarPlay when not set
When selecting the magnifying glass for an address in Waze on CarPlay, the first two options are the Home and Work shortcuts/favorites, which appear regardless if they have been setup in the app or not. This request is to hide either or both if there is not an address assigned (or have an option to hide them altogether).
